  • Publication number: 20140017356
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a process for preparing a whole grain cereal based extract having improved suspension properties. The process comprises the steps of: (i) providing a whole grain cereal; (ii) subjecting the whole grain cereal to a first grinding; (iii) subjecting the ground whole grain cereal to an hydrolysis of the macromolecular elements providing a modified whole grain cereal; (iv) separating a soluble fraction of the modified whole grain cereal from an insoluble fraction of the modified whole grain cereal; and (v) subjecting the insoluble fraction of the modified whole grain cereal to a second grinding and/or enzymatic modification obtaining a cereal based fraction having improved suspension properties, and comprising particles having a particle size of at the most 100 ?m, such as at the most 50 ?m, e.g.

  • Publication number: 20130259974
    Abstract: The present invention relates to instant drink powders comprising a primary ingredient of particles or agglomerated particles having a particle size below 500 ?m, a hydrolyzed whole grain composition, an alpha-amylase or fragments thereof, which alpha-amylase or fragments thereof show no hydrolytic activity towards dietary fibers when in the active state; and a moisture content of at most 5% (w/w) of the instant drink powder.

  • Patent number: 6171634
    Abstract: To prepare a food product, dehydrated pregelatinized starch and a mixture of hydrated gelatinized starch, fat and water are introduced into an apparatus for mixing and cooling the same to a temperature between −8° C. and −3° C. so that a frozen mixture is obtained from the apparatus, and then the frozen mixture is cut into portions and the portions are frozen. The hydrated gelatinized starch may be prepared by treating a dehydrated pregelatinized starch in admixture with water and fat so that it hydrates and swells, or it may be obtained by heating native/raw starch in admixture with water and fat by heating to hydrate and gelatinize the starch.
